#pequena {
	color: #555555;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: xx-small;
}
	
#imgdes {
	border-color: #003333;
}

#micro{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	vertical-align: top;
	font-style: normal;
	color: #ffffff;
	text-align:left;
	}	

body {
	scrollbar-3d-light-color: White;
	scrollbar-arrow-color: Black;
	scrollbar-base-color: #009999;
	scrollbar-dark-shadow-color: Black;
	scrollbar-face-color: #009999;
	scrollbar-highlight-color: #DC143C;
	scrollbar-shadow-color: #009999;
	scrollbar-track-color: #000033;
	background-color: #FFFFFF;
}
table.total {
	width: auto;
	height:auto;
	text-align:center;
	background-color: #ffffff;
}
table.topo {
	width: 755px;
	height: 60px;
	background-color: #ffffff;
}
table.principal {
	width: 755px;
	background-color: #FFFFFF;
}
td.logo{
	width: 287px;
	height: 60px;
	background-image:url(/imagens/logo2.jpg)
}
td.hora{
	background-color: #000033;
	color: #ffffff;
	text-align: right;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	border-top-color:#999900;
	border-top-style:solid;
	border-top-width:thin;
}

td.menu {
	background-color: #009999;
	color: White;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	text-align: center;
}

td.foto {
	color: #555555;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: x-small;
	vertical-align: middle;
	text-align: center;
	padding: 10px;	
	background: #FFFFFF;
}
TD.textofoto {
	color: #191970;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: center;
	text-decoration: none;
}

TD.entrevista {
	text-align: justify;
	vertical-align: middle;
	background: #009999;
	font-style: normal;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#FFFFFF;
	padding: 5px;
}

fieldset {
  padding: 1em;
  font:80%/1 sans-serif;
  }
label {
  float:left;
  width:25%;
  margin-right:0.5em;
  padding-top:0.2em;
  text-align:right;
  font-weight:bold;
  }
legend {
  padding: 0.2em 0.5em;
  border:1px solid green;
  color:green;
  font-size:90%;
  text-align:right;
  }

h1 {
	color: #555555;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	text-align: center;
}

td.esquerda {
	color: #555555;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: center;
	padding: 10px;
	background: #FBFDFF;
	border: thin dotted #708090;
}
td.amarela{
	color: #555555;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: justify;
	padding: 10px;
	background: #FFFFFA;
	border: thin dotted #708090;
}
td.titulo {
	color: #555555;
	background: #F5FFFA;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: small;
	vertical-align: top;
	text-align: left;
	padding: 5px;
	font-weight: bold;
}
TD.titulo2 {
	color: #000000;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: small;
	vertical-align: top;
	text-align: center;
	padding: 5px;	
	background: #ffffff;
}
td.principal {
	color: black;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: small;
	vertical-align: top;
	text-align: justify;
	padding: 10px;
	background: #FFFAFA;
}

td.direita {
	color: #555555;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: justify;
	padding: 10px;
	background: #F5FFFA;
	border: thin dotted #708090;
}
td.pequena {
	color: #666666;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: center;
	background: #FFFFF0;
	padding: 10px;
}

a.menu {
	color: #ffffff;
	font-family: Arial, Helvetica, sans-serif;
	font-size: small;
	text-decoration: none;
	text-align: center;
	vertical-align: middle;
}

a.menu:hover {
	text-decoration: underline;
	color:#000033;
}

a.descreve {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	color: #000033;
	text-decoration: none;
	text-align: center;
}
a.descreve:hover {
	text-decoration: underline;
}

a.principal {
	color: #006699;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: x-small;
	text-decoration: none;
}
a.principal:hover {
	text-decoration: underline; 
}

a.simples {
	color: #006699;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	background: transparent;
	text-decoration: none;
}
a.simples:hover {
	text-decoration: underline;
}
a.pequena {
	color: #006699;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: center;
	text-decoration: none;
}
a.pequena:hover {
	text-decoration: underline;
}

td.subtitulo {
	color: #666666;
	font-family: "MS Sans Serif", Geneva,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: justify;
	padding: 10px;
	background: #FFFFFF;
}

td.subtitulo2 {
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: justify;
	padding: 10px;
	background: #FFFAFA;
}
td.subtitulo3 {
	color: #666666;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: justify;
	padding: 10px;
	background: #FFFFFF;
}

td.formesq {
	color: #333333;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font: x-small;
	text-align: right;
	vertical-align: top;
}
TD.formdir {
	color: #000000;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font: x-small;
	color: #000000;
	text-align: left;
	vertical-align: top;
}

TEXTAREA.formtext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font : x-small;
	background : White;
	color : Black;
}
TD.pequeno {
	color: #666666;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: left;
	padding: 5px;
	background: White;
}

td.rodape {
	width: 755px;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: #ffffff;
	text-align: center;
	background-color: #000066;
	padding-bottom: 5px;
	padding-top: 5px;
}
a.laca {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	color: Black;
	text-align: center;
	background-color: #ffffff;
	vertical-align: middle;
	text-decoration: none;
}
a.laca:hover {
	text-decoration: underline;
}
td.contato {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: xx-small;
	color: Black;
	background-color: transparent;
	text-align: center;
}
TD.laca {
	color: #191970;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
	vertical-align: top;
	text-align: center;
	text-decoration: none;
	background-color: White;
}

.obs{
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#666666;
	background-color:#FFFFFF;
	line-height:11px;
}


/* CoolMenus 4 - default styles - do not edit */
.clCMAbs{position:absolute; visibility:hidden; left:0; top:0}
/* CoolMenus 4 - default styles - end */
  
/*Style for the background-bar*/
.clBar{position:relative; width:740px; height:18px; background-color:#009999; layer-background-color:#CCCCCC; visibility:hidden}

/*Styles for level 0*/
.clLevel0,.clLevel0over{position:absolute; padding:2px; font-family:Arial, Helvetica, sans-serif; font-size:12px; font-weight:normal}
.clLevel0{background-color:#009999; layer-background-color:#009999; color:#FFFFFF;}
.clLevel0over{background-color:#006699; layer-background-color:#006699; color:#FFFFFF; cursor:hand; cursor:hand; }
.clLevel0border{position:absolute; visibility:hidden; background-color:#333333; layer-background-color:#990000}

/*Styles for level 1*/
.clLevel1, .clLevel1over{position:absolute; padding:2px;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al}
.clLevel1{background-color:#009999; layer-background-color:#009999; color:#FFFFFF;}
.clLevel1over{background-color:#006699; layer-background-color:#006699; color:#FFFFFF; cursor:hand; cursor:hand; }
.clLevel1border{position:absolute; visibility:hidden; background-color:#333333; layer-background-color:#990000}

/*Styles for level 2*/
.clLevel2, .clLevel2over{position:absolute; padding:2px; font-family:Arial, Helvetica, sans-serif; font-size:10px; font-weight:normal}
.clLevel2{background-color:#FFFFFF; layer-background-color:#FFFFFF; color:#666666;}
.clLevel2over{background-color:#006699; layer-background-color:#006699; color:#CCCCCC; cursor:hand; cursor:hand; }
.clLevel2border{position:absolute; visibility:hidden; background-color:#333333; layer-background-color:#990000}